Karen “Kay” Kimbrell, born on February 13, 1945, in Fenner, NY, passed away on March 28, 2025, at Forsyth Medical Center in Winston-Salem, NC.
“Grandma Kay” was a whirlwind of humor, love, and authenticity, leaving everyone in her wake with a smile and a story. She was a devoted wife to her husband, James Kenneth Kimbrell (Ken), and a wonderful mother, grandmother, and great-grandmother to many.
For over 40 years, Kay was a nurse who cared for others with a mix of compassion and a dash of her signature humor. As the matriarch of her family, she was a culinary wizard. She whipped up meals that were as delicious as they were uniquely her own, with ingredients measured in “a pinch of love” and “a dash of whatever feels right.”
Kay was unapologetically herself, a trait that made for some really great social media posts, and some seriously funny in-person moments! She had a knack for seeing the genuine version of everyone that she came in contact with, and didn’t mind sharing her opinion.
She was preceded in death by her parents Roy Christenson & Eula Loop, her brothers Bill & Dick, and her sisters Beverly & Eutina. She leaves behind her loving husband, Ken Kimbrell; a brother Roy, her children Brian (Michelle), Belinda, Joel (Mindi), & Michael; her grand children Brandon (Leahann), Jessica (Justin), Tiffany, Samantha, Christopher (Victoria), Jamie, Lindsay (Michael), Taylor (Andy) and Dominic (Kimberly); and her great -grandchildren Michael, Alexea, Landon, Savanna, Eli, Ryan, Evelyn, Asher, Leo, Jack, Tate, Reese, and Maya; all of the loving children, grand children, and great-grandchildren she inherited by marrying Ken, and numerous nieces and nephews.
As we remember Grandma Kay, we celebrate a remarkable woman whose spirit will live on in the hearts of all who knew and loved her.
